Use the term sea floor spreading to explain how a mid oceanic ridge forms.

Seafloor spreading helps explain continental drift in the theory of plate tectonics. When oceanic plates diverge, tensional stress causes fractures to occur in the lithosphere. ... At a spreading center, basaltic magma rises up the fractures and cools on the ocean floor to form new seabed.
